Soft Reveal
The sun gently illuminates a fishing boat in Pembroke Dock, Wales as the last of the morning mist is spirited away.
I photographed this image early on Easter Sunday, leaving early and driving through the thick mist to Pembroke Dock. When I got to the waterside, there was not much to see, the fog being so thick. I parked up and waited and as I peered out into the mist, things began to reveal themselves. Within just a few minutes, the mist had burnt off and the magic of that morning was replaced with just another harbour view. Timing it seems, is everything.
Canon 10D
1/500th sec at f 6.3
35-135mm Canon lens at 135mm
ISO 100
